Charles P. Blackshear is a scholar working on Genetics, Surgery and Biomaterials. According to data from OpenAlex, Charles P. Blackshear has authored 16 papers receiving a total of 234 indexed citations (citations by other indexed papers that have themselves been cited), including 13 papers in Genetics, 9 papers in Surgery and 7 papers in Biomaterials. Recurrent topics in Charles P. Blackshear's work include Mesenchymal stem cell research (13 papers), Electrospun Nanofibers in Biomedical Applications (6 papers) and Body Contouring and Surgery (4 papers). Charles P. Blackshear is often cited by papers focused on Mesenchymal stem cell research (13 papers), Electrospun Nanofibers in Biomedical Applications (6 papers) and Body Contouring and Surgery (4 papers). Charles P. Blackshear collaborates with scholars based in United States, India and Australia. Charles P. Blackshear's co-authors include Derrick C. Wan, Michael T. Longaker, Elizabeth A. Brett, Arash Momeni, Elizabeth R. Zielins, Geoffrey C. Gurtner, Dung Nguyen, Ryan C. Ransom, Gordon K. Lee and Anna Luan and has published in prestigious journals such as Nature Communications, Plastic & Reconstructive Surgery and Journal of the American College of Surgeons.
